Any version from Nero from 5.5.5.1 and up have full support for WinXP.
download the demo to see if you like it, as it does take some getting used to from Adaptec.
why did you format your CD's with Direct CD? seems like kind of a waste...doesn't the Direct CD take up 100+MB of space on the CD? i read somewhere they did. if not, no biggie.
And Nero does a fine job of reading "Unfinalized" CD's. that's how some of my CD"s are, so I can just keep on adding on to them.

That extra space on your Direct CDRW's will include a reader program. So if you uninstall EasyCD and install Nero, when you load up one of your RW's set for Direct CD, it will promt you to install the reader.
